F/A Loan Counseling Service Advisor
Kaplan Division: Kaplan University City: Fort Lauderdale State/Province: Florida Position Type Full Time Job Level: Some Experience Job Description Loan Counseling Services Advisors assist and motivate a cohort of students no longer enrolled at Kaplan University to enter into repayment of their Federal Student Loans through outbound call attempts and correspondence via electrionic and regular mail. - Maintain a cohort list of students that are past due on their federal student loan payments - Enter Student Data, obtained from guarantor, delinquent borrower lists, into the Campus 2000 system and other internal systems - Research student federal aid history with NSLDS and other external systems -Help students understand their repayment options - Maintain telephone coverage during assigned hours, including answering inbound calls from students and internal customers and making outbound calls on various campaigns - Skip Trace delinquent students to obtain and up current contact information into Campus 2000 and other internal systems. - Follow up with delinquent Students via e-mail, telephone and various other communication methods - Understand and answer general questions regarding Federal Aid repayment options - Conduct self according to Kaplan's expectations. This includes schedule adherence, attending required training classes, and adherence to all SOP's. A likely activities breakdown (must equal 100%): - Outbound, telephone contact attempts to out of school students (65%) - Managing returned mail (15%) - Skip Trace delinquent students to obtain current contact information (10%) - Attend required training sessions/huddles (5%) - Other related duties as assigned (5%) Minimum Requirements: Associate's degree from an accredited school required or must be currently enrolled in an accredited bachelor's degree program. Bachelor's degree from an accredited school preferred. One to two years experience and/or training Customer Service or Collections Call Center Extensive working knowledge of PC and the Microsoft Windows and Outlook - Excellent knowledge of Microsoft Office programs (Word, Excel, Power Point) - Skilled communicator, both via phone and in writing (e-mail) - Possessing excellent analytical and negotiation skills - Ability to problem-solve customer issues - Adaptable to change - Service oriented - Ability to succeed in a team environment - - Flexible with any schedule between Monday - Saturday, from 9:00 a.m. - 10:00 p.m. Eastern. - Loan Counseling Services Advisors working a Monday - Friday schedule need to be available for occasional Saturday overtime.
